Pictonico! (Japanese: ピクトニコ!, Hepburn: Pikutoniko!) is a 2026 video game developed by Nintendo EPD and Intelligent Systems and published by Nintendo for iOS and Android. The game allows users to turn their photos into a game. The game released on May 28, 2026.

Gameplay

Pictonico! is a mobile video game where players can take pictures using their camera or use their pictures on their phone and turn them into WarioWare-style minigames. Each minigame lasts a few seconds and is controlled with the device’s touch screen. The minigame alters the selected image for use in the game, similar to that in the Nintendo 3DS game Face Raiders. Around 80 minigames are available in total. The game features several game modes, such as a stage by stage progression mode, a “score attack” challenge mode, a high speed mode, and a “sudden death” mode.

Development and release

Pictonico! was developed by Nintendo EPD and by Intelligent Systems, the developers behind the WarioWare series of games.

Pictonico! was announced on May 18, 2026 through a trailer on the Nintendo Today! app showcasing the minigames alongside the release date of May 28, 2026 for iOS and Android.

Similar to Super Mario Run, the game is free to download and start, but only a handful of minigames can be played for free as a demo. The full game must be purchased via two separate minigame “volumes”. Unlike Super Mario Run, the game does not require a constant active internet connection; it is needed only for the first launch, changing languages, and when purchasing and downloading minigame volumes. No photos are sent to Nintendo’s servers.
